The Israeli military said on Friday it had found the bodies of three Israeli hostages killed in Gaza on October 7 by Hamas - the terrorist group designated by the United States and the European Union.
The bodies found are those of 22-year-old Shani Louk, 28-year-old Amit Buskila, and 56-year-old Itzhak Gelerenter.
The Israel Defense Forces (IDF) said they were killed on October 7 in southern Israel while fleeing the Nova music festival, where Hamas militants killed hundreds of people, and that their bodies were taken to the Gaza Strip.
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u vowed that "we will return all our hostages, living and dead."
The IDF said their bodies were found overnight, but did not say exactly where in Gaza they were found.
In recent weeks, the Israeli army has been operating in the southern Gaza Strip city of Rafah. The IDF says it has indications that hostages are being held in Rafah.
Hamas fighters killed around 1,200 people, mostly civilians, and kidnapped around 250 others during the October 7 attack.
About half of the hostages have been released, most in exchange for Palestinian prisoners held by Israel, during a week-long ceasefire in November.
Israel says around 100 hostages are still being held in Gaza, along with the bodies of around 30 others.
Israel's war on Gaza since October 7 has killed more than 35,000 Palestinians, according to Gaza health officials.
Netanyahu has vowed to wipe out Hamas and return all hostages, but he has made little progress on that front. He faces pressure to resign, while the United States has threatened to cut aid because of the humanitarian situation in Gaza.
Israelis are divided into two camps: those who want the government to stop the war and release the hostages, and others who think the hostages are an unfortunate price to pay for destroying Hamas.
Negotiations for a ceasefire and the release of the hostages, brokered by Qatar, the US and Egypt, have not borne fruit so far. / REL
